INGREDIENTS
Main
- 5g ito kanten
- 1/3 bunch chives
- 1 tbsp sakura ebi
- 2 tbsp sesame oil
Batter
- 3 tbsp flour
- 1 tbsp potato starch
- đź’§ 2 tbsp water
- 🥚 1 egg
Sauce
- 1 tbsp vinegar
- 2 tsp soy sauce
- 1 tsp sesame oil
STEPS
Soak ito kanten in water to rehydrate, then drain. Cut chives into 4cm pieces.
Mix the batter ingredients (flour, potato starch, water, and egg) in a bowl.
Add the rehydrated ito kanten, chives, and sakura ebi to the batter and mix well.
Prepare the dipping sauce by mixing vinegar, soy sauce, and sesame oil in a container.
Heat sesame oil in a frying pan over medium heat. Pour the batter into the pan and cook until golden brown. Flip and cook until fully cooked and golden on both sides. Cut into bite-sized pieces and serve with the dipping sauce.

đź’ˇ Tips
Ito kanten adds a unique texture and is low in calories, making this dish both satisfying and healthy.You can substitute sakura ebi with other small dried seafood or omit for a vegetarian version.Serve immediately for the best taste and texture.
